LFA Champ Bruno Souza Replaces T.J. Laramie, Meets Melsik Baghdasaryan at UFC 268



Legacy Fighting Alliance featherweight champ Bruno Souza will step in on short notice to face Melsik Baghdasaryan at UFC 268 on Saturday.

Souza is a replacement for T.J. Laramie, who recently announced his withdrawal from the event due to an MRSA infection. MMA DNA was first to report the new pairing. UFC 268 takes place at Madison Square Garden in New York and is headlined by a welterweight title rematch between Kamaru Usman and Colby Covington.

A protégé of former UFC title holder Lyoto Machida, Souza has been victorious in 10 of his first 11 professional outings. The 25-year-old known as “The Tiger” captured featherweight gold with a unanimous verdict against Javier Garcia at LFA 114 on Aug. 27. He also owns notable wins over UFC talent Kamuela Kirk and Bellator veteran Mike Hamel.

Anchored at Glendale Fighting Club, Baghdasaryan is a former competitor on Dana White’s Contender Series. Though he didn’t initially earn a contract with his win over Dennis Buzukja in 2020, he made his Octagon debut at UFC on ESPN 28, where he knocked out Collin Anglin in the second round.
